Mercer University is searching for a Maintenance Technician II for the Atlanta, Georgia campus.


 

Responsibilities:

Working under the general supervision of the Area Supervisor,  this position performs a broad range of building maintenance tasks for all University facilities in the areas of carpentry, electrical, plumbing, general maintenance, and locksmith duties.  Communicates with various faculty, staff, and students to keep them informed on repair work which impacts them.  Must have good organizational skills to keep up with the heavy workload, and manage the elated paperwork.  Performs other duties as assigned.  The end results of this job allow the Physical Plant to provide good customer service for the campus' students, faculty, and staff, which includes helping the Physical Plant keep the campus well-maintained, safe, and comfortable.

Qualifications:

A high school diploma or GED and at least two (2) years of maintenance/construction experience or combination of maintenance/construction experience and technical education are required.

Candidates must have a valid driver's license.

Knowledge/Skills/Abilities:

  • Ability to work somewhat independently with a minimum amount of supervision so that work can be accomplished efficiently.

  • Ability to analyze problems and make repairs.  

  • Working knowledge of carpentry, general repairs, plumbing systems, and electrical systems in commercial buildings.

  • Effective oral communication skills and competency in written communication.

  • Must have good organizational skills to effectively manage the paperwork associated with the job requirements, and the ability to prioritize work responsibilities.

  • Knowledge and ability in using computers, including utilizing email systems to be able to communicate with others effectively and to input information related to purchasing card receipts.

  • Physical abilities to be able to lift and carry large objects (up to 25 lbs. periodically and up to 75 lbs. occasionally), access confined spaces, and climb ladders with or without reasonable accommodation.

  • Must have a valid driver’s license so that a University golf cart can be driven.

  • Must be able to work effectively with customers.

  • Ability to manage work being performed by contractors.
